Yeah some will say date matters. I.e. a 4 yr old tire ain't a new tire, rubber dries and hardens. Anyway, I did check the One I bought from them and it was manufactured that year. But the tire I just had them install, which I got from the PO was a 2009. I should have asked him where he got it. Anyway it's on the FZ now and doing just fine.
